Top Finiko Crypto Pyramid Executive Arrested in Russia’s Tatarstan

Top Finiko Crypto Pyramid Executive Arrested in Russia’s TatarstanA high-ranking representative of Russia’s notorious Finiko Ponzi scheme has been arrested in Tatarstan. Ilgiz Shakirov, a businessman from Kazan, rose to the rank of vice president of the crypto pyramid which is believed to have defrauded millions of investors in the Russian Federation and surrounding regions. Onecoin Offices Raided in Sofia, Servers Shut Down

Onecoin Offices Raided in Sofia, Servers Shut DownBulgarian law enforcement agencies have raided the offices of Onecoin in Sofia as part of a multinational effort to neutralize what authorities call a “centralized cryptocurrency pyramid scheme”.
